About the Book

UNFORGETTABLE ISLANDS TO ESCAPE TO BEFORE YOU DIE is the fourth title in the best-selling Unforgettable series which has been published in 23 languages and has sold more than half a million copies worldwide, including more than 300,000 copies in the UK, to date.International travel writers and photographers Steve Davey and Marc Schlossman draw on their years of experience in selecting forty unusual and amazing islands that can help you find paradise during a break of two weeks or less.Their suggestions feature some highly individual destinations, ranging from the hustle and bustle of Hong Kong Island and Isle de la Cite in Paris, to the arctic beauty of Spitzbergen and the tropical haven of Palawan in the Philippines.Lavishly illustrated throughout with more than 300 specially commissioned photographs, UNFORGETTABLE ISLANDS TO ESCAPE TO BEFORE YOU DIE is aimed at anyone looking for ideas for an inspirational experience of a lifetime.Islands featured-Eleuthera, The Bahamas; Kubu Island, Botswana; Islands of Lake Tana, Ethiopia; Pico Ruivo, Madeira; Sagar, India; Islands of Serenity, Tokyo, Japan; The Vanuatu Archipelago, South Western Pacific; Cousine and Praslin Islands, The Seychelles; Hong Kong Island, China; Si Phan Don, Laos; El Nido Islands, Palawan, Philippines; Amorgos, Greece; The Golden Temple, Amritsar, India; The Florida Keys, USA; Bali, Indonesia; Santa Barbara Islands, USA; Southern Dalmatian Islands, Croatia; Yasawa Islands, Fiji; Madagascar; Lord Howe Island, Australia; Sri Lanka; Sark, Channel Islands, UK; Lamu, Kenya; Rapa Nui (Easter Island); sle de la Cite, Paris, France; Isles of Scilly, UK; St Lucia, Caribbean; Ibiza, Balearic Islands; Big Island, Hawaii, USA; Mont Saint-Michel, France; Svalbard, Norway; The Society Islands, French Polynesia; Stockholm, Sweden; Tierra del Fuego, Argentina; Phang Nga Bay Islands, Thailand; Newfoundland, Canada; Socotra, Republic of Yemen; Sicily, Italy; Isle of Skye, Scotland; Mount Desert Island, USA

About the Author :
Steve Davey is the author of the first book in this series, Unforgettable Places to See Before You Die. A writer and photographer, Steve has turned his day job into a way of life. He graduated with a photographic degree in 1988 and has travelled compulsively ever since, photographing amazing places, cultures and festivals. Steve markets his work through La Belle Aurore, the agency he co-founded in 1992, and his words and pictures have appeared in many publications around the world. Marc Schlossman was born in Chicago and has been based in London since 1988. From a beginning in editorial photography and photojournalism, his work has evolved into a variety of personal and commissioned projects using a combination of documentary, landscape and photojournalism techniques to tell stories with photographs. Marc was the co-photographer for Unforgettable Places to See Before You Die.
